If the volume of the pyramid shown is 360 inches cubed, what is its height?
dimaraw [331]

Answer:

9 inches

Step-by-step explanation:

The formula for the volume of a rectangular pyramid is V = \frac{1}{3}(l*w*h)

  • Here we have volume (V), base (L), and width (W)
  • V = 360 in³, L = 12 in, W = 10 in

We need to manipulate the volume equation to solve for the height (H)

  • First we need to multiply both sides by 3 to get rid of the fraction:  3V = L×W×H
  • Then we need to divide both sides by (L×W) to get: \frac{3V}{lw} =h

Now we can plug in the given values:

  • \frac{3(360in^{3}) }{(12 in)(10in)} =\frac{1080in^{3} }{120in^{2} } = 9in
  • The height is 9 inches

Use synthetic division and the remainder theorem to find p(a) = 2x3 -x2 + 10x; = a = 1/2
sergey [27]

Answer:

p(1/2) = 5

Step-by-step explanation:

Find the value of p(1/2) if p(x) = 2x^3 -x^2 + 10x

Set up synthetic div.:

1/2   )   2   -1    10   0

                1      0    5

       ------------------------

           2   0    10     5

The remainder is 5, so we conclude that p(x) = 2x^3 -x^2 + 10x = 5 when x = 1/2.
